Average household size
2.42021▼ -4.0%
Port Stephens's household size is 2.4 — around the middle of the range.
It ranks 227th of 550 council areas nationally — lower than 57% of them.
Port Stephens has a higher household size than nearby Mid-Coast, but a lower one than Central Coast (NSW), Lake Macquarie and Dungog.
Since 2011, it has fallen 4% (from 2.5).
Within Port Stephens it varies widely — from 2.2 in Nelson Bay Peninsula to 3.0 in Seaham - Woodville.
